Transaction 1890e225ba66fda6682cdfb45121161d0caea15677d4d818945b000f73a66b92
1 Input
1 Output
-
1890e225ba66fda6682cdfb45121161d0caea15677d4d818945b000f73a66b92:0
- value
- 303846
- script pubkey
- OP_0 OP_PUSHBYTES_20 e70d34c52a4f65258595e1d974170ffb0891813e
- address
- bc1quuxnf3f2fajjtpv4u8vhg9c0lvyfrqf7g2hffw